Transaction 295c9136036f50950b0a3ee90be1a664c082309fcbe1c4085a09207a52723aa4

1 Input
2 Outputs
  • 295c9136036f50950b0a3ee90be1a664c082309fcbe1c4085a09207a52723aa4:0
  • value  15506470
    address  1LujsNiRGbyu8Euxnan8TnDLthEBBwgizH
  • 295c9136036f50950b0a3ee90be1a664c082309fcbe1c4085a09207a52723aa4:1
  • value  17293467
    address  13UdnApGYjtvSHLnvDjFEHNpPfgHdZ16mb